Digital Technology Software Engineering Apprenticeship
As a Software Engineering Degree Apprentice, you’ll learn to configure solutions, write code in C#, TypeScript and React, and support customer solutions using Microsoft Power Platform. This will incorporate AI as a feature of the solution.
Role
An average week will include working with your team on customer projects, attending training or university study, and developing software solutions. Tasks may include configuring the Microsoft Power Platform, writing and testing code, fixing bugs, supporting live systems, and learning how AI tools are used in real projects. Apprentices are trained to create, design, develop, test and deliver high-quality digital software solutions for organisations. The software engineer specialism sits within a broader digital and technology apprenticeship, equipping learners to work across the full software development lifecycle.
- Monitoring the support queue and investigating any customer issues
- Configuring the Microsoft Platform
- Writing code to meet customer requirements
- Talking to customers and gathering customer requirements
Training
- BSc (Hons) Digital and Technology Solutions (Software Engineering)
- Day Release Study at Nottingham Trent University at NTU Clifton campus
We hope after you have completed your apprenticeship, you will stay working with Vigence and become a consultant and then a Senior Consultant. These roles will mean you will have more responsibility, including Project Management, Pre-Sales work and Training staff/ customers.
